Documentation Structure

Project documentation is split into two directories:

spec/ - Formal Requirements

Contains formal requirements documents defining WHAT the system does, WHY it exists, and HOW to build/deploy it.

Format: {audience}-{topic}(-{subtopic}).md

Audiences:

  • prd: Product Requirements - High-level, evaluation for suitability
  • ops: DevOps - Deployment, maintenance, operations, monitoring
  • dev: Developers - Code practices, libraries, implementation

Key Topics: app, database, security, clinical-trials

See: spec/README.md for complete hierarchical documentation map and topic scope definitions.

docs/ - Implementation Documentation

Contains Architecture Decision Records (ADRs), implementation guides, and technical explanations of HOW decisions were made.

Includes:

  • adr/ - Architecture Decision Records documenting major technical decisions
  • Implementation tutorials and guides
  • Investigation reports and research findings

See: docs/README.md for complete documentation about when to use docs/ vs spec/.

Development Environment

The Clinical Diary project uses Docker-based containerized development environments to ensure consistency, security, and FDA compliance.

Quick Start Options:

🌐 GitHub Codespaces (5 minutes, recommended for remote teams):

  1. Go to: https://github.com/yourorg/clinical-diary
  2. Click "Code" → "Codespaces" → "Create codespace"
  3. Choose your role → Start coding!

💻 Local Dev Containers (1-2 hours):

cd tools/dev-env
./setup.sh

Features:

  • 🚀 Role-Based Containers: Separate environments for dev, qa, ops, and management
  • 🔒 Security: Isolated workspaces with role-specific permissions
  • 📦 Pre-Configured Tools: Flutter, Node.js, Python, Playwright, Terraform, and more
  • 🔄 CI/CD Ready: Same environment locally and in GitHub Actions
  • FDA Validated: IQ/OQ/PQ protocols for 21 CFR Part 11 compliance
  • 🌍 Cross-Platform: Linux, macOS, and Windows (WSL2)

Supported Roles:

  • dev: Full development environment (Flutter, Android SDK, Node.js, Python)
  • qa: Testing environment (Playwright, Flutter tests, report generation)
  • ops: DevOps environment (Terraform, gcloud CLI, Cosign, Syft)
  • mgmt: Read-only management environment (Git viewing, report access)

Database Files

Located in database/ directory:

  • schema.sql - Core table definitions and extensions
  • triggers.sql - Event store triggers and validation
  • roles.sql - User roles and permissions
  • rls_policies.sql - Row-level security policies
  • indexes.sql - Performance indexes
  • init.sql - Master initialization script
